ABOUT THE PROPERTY

Rare opportunity in South Jersey. This +/- 20acre parcel can accommodate up to 95,000 SF of contiguous space, ideal for big box, entertainment, medical or multi-tenant concepts. (Redevelopment Opportunity) Highlights: Excellent visibility, signage opportunity and access. Overhead dock doors and tractor-trailer friendly. Ample parking and flexible site layout.
